Want to uninstall internal modem without physically removing it

I have a Dimension 4600 with internal Conexant modem.  Following a thunderstorm the modem is out of action.  I have bought a USB external modem, but it won't work unless I uninstall the internal modem.  Each time I use Device Manager to uninstall the internal modem, plug and play reinstalls it.  Is there a way to permanently uninstall the internal modem without opening the PC to take it out (I am reluctant to do this)?

No.  The internal modem will have to be physically removed.  Even if you were not using any modem it would still be better to remove the defective device as it could cause other system problems or even internal PC power problems depending on how it's damaged.
